  It had gotten to Friday night, and there was a party atmosphere in the common room. The O.W.L. and N.E.W.T. students were looking to let off some steam after the intense two weeks that they had just experienced. It was noisy and chaotic, the other years more than happy to join in the festivities. Bottles of Butterbeer and Firewhiskey were passed around, and Draco was tempted to partake of the latter, but knew he would regret it the next day. He and Hermione had agreed to stay in their respective common rooms this evening; Hermione because she wanted to unwind with her house mates, him because he couldn’t think of a good enough reason not to. He was unsurprised when he was joined in the corner of the common room by Theo, who like himself was not quite part of the celebrating crowd.
